The Breakthrough (originally titled Genombrottet) is a gripping 2025 Swedish Netflix limited series that dramatizes one of the most significant true-crime investigations in Sweden’s history. Directed by Lisa Siwe, the show meticulously reconstructs the 16-year quest for justice following a shocking double homicide that occurred in 2004.

1080p Resolution: This provides a crisp 1920x1080 pixel display, which has become the baseline for home theater enthusiasts who want a cinematic experience without the massive bandwidth requirements of 4K.
WEB-DL Source: Unlike "WEBRip," which is a screen capture of a stream, a WEB-DL is a lossless extraction of the file directly from a streaming service like Netflix, Amazon Prime, or HBO Max. This ensures there is no degradation in quality.
h264 (AVC): This codec is the industry workhorse. It is compatible with almost every device, from smart TVs and game consoles to older smartphones, making it the most versatile format for casual viewers. What is "The Breakthrough"?

A four-part limited series based on the real-life 2004 double homicide in Linköping, Sweden. The case remained cold for 16 years until it was solved using groundbreaking forensic genetic genealogy. Episode 1: "The Unthinkable" ( Det ofattbara
